I'm a guard dog
And I am sad,
Can't remember
Ever feeling glad.
I've never known
A kindly word,
And a caring voice
I've never heard.
When people pass
I bark and run,
I'm simply scared
Of everyone.
Each night alone
Beneath the stars,
In a yard of junk
And rusty cars.
I had never thought about the suffering of guard dogs until I came across this German shepherd locked up in an old car wreckers yard. When I approached the wire gate to speak to him, he was so fearful, he ran away. It was pitiful to see what this powerful looking animal had been reduced to.
